Transaction f62ddecd0632c2fb682b2f80b0b1ff43001bf49961c48eb5605fac4ea7982526
1 Input
1 Output
-
f62ddecd0632c2fb682b2f80b0b1ff43001bf49961c48eb5605fac4ea7982526:0
- value
- 105176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6800b18e9abefbe0b90dfc00592ad3bf21282f6 OP_EQUAL
- address
- 3GsPUzgxLpsvurQYaBcKFx3cBGWo3C7xw9